[0013] Such as figure 1 A dual-electric low-pressure hydraulic control electromagnetic reversing valve test system described in 2, including a test power supply 1, a test oil source 2, a filter 3, an accumulator 4, an overflow valve 5, a one-way valve 6, and a pressure gauge 7. Pressure sensor 8, hydraulic pump 9, high-pressure cut-off valve 10, flow meter 11, hydraulic actuator 12, monitoring camera 13, bearing chamber 14 and control system 15, wherein the bearing chamber is a closed cavity structure, and the pressure chamber 14 At least one positioning platform 16 is provided, and at least one water injection port 141 and one sewage discharge port 142 are provided on the pressure chamber 14.
